There are no specific collective noun for tulips. I have seen suggested, an explosion of tulips and a tiptoe of tulips. However, any noun suitable for the situation can be used, for example, a field of tulips, a bouquet of tulips, a bunch of tulips, etc.

Tulips may die quickly due to factors such as inadequate watering, poor soil quality, pests, diseases, or extreme temperatures. It's important to ensure proper care and maintenance to help tulips thrive and last longer.
